  1. Yes it is and I assume if Finch wasn't repped by Spencer then his cover would have been a lot more affordable. I think his move to have Spencer rep him has signalled the end of the attainable for the average person Finch cover. Finch was represented by spencer for quite a while, and then decided to sell his own artwork around 2009, I had purchased several covers during the time he was with spencer. The prices were higher after he left. If they are higher now I wouldn't say it has anything to do with spencer and more to do with finch's career arc taking his prices up or finch deciding he wants more for his work. I agree. I purchased my Finch Batman page from Spencer. Only way I could get a page that I wanted. I thought the price was VERY fair. Matter of fact, I thought I got a pretty good deal on it. Spencer is very easy to deal with.
